The food truck industry in India has grown rapidly in recent years. More people are looking for quick, tasty, and affordable food options, especially in urban areas. Food trucks offer a unique experience by combining street food culture with mobility. This business suits cities with busy streets, office areas, and college campuses.
Here are some reasons why starting a food truck business in India is a good idea:
However, running a food truck also comes with challenges like weather dependency, parking restrictions, and competition. Knowing these will help you plan better.

Marketing helps you attract customers and build a loyal following.
Create profiles on Instagram, Facebook, and Twitter. Share photos of your food, daily locations, and special offers. Engage with followers by responding to comments and messages.
Join food festivals, local events, and markets. Partner with offices or colleges for catering opportunities.
Discounts, combo deals, and loyalty cards encourage repeat customers.
Tie up with apps like Zomato and Swiggy to reach more customers who prefer delivery.

Starting costs vary but typically range from ₹5 lakh to ₹15 lakh, including the truck, equipment, licenses, and initial inventory.
Yes, you need an FSSAI license, health trade license, and vehicle permits to operate legally.
Yes, but gaining some knowledge of cooking, hygiene, and business management helps improve your chances of success.
Look for busy areas like office complexes, colleges, markets, and events with high foot traffic and legal parking options.
